Congress came to power with false promises and  fake declarations: KTR

Hyderabad: BRS working president KT Rama Rao alleged Congress came into power by spreading smear campaign against the BRS govt. He said the Congress made false promises and fake declarations during the 2023 assembly elections. It was due to Congress’s poisonous propaganda that BRS suffered defeat at that time, KTR said.The Congress party, which came through the backdoor, has pushed Telangana back by 25 years. Revanth Reddy is turning the state, which he himself described as a platter full of abundance, into a discarded platter.Speaking at the Telangana formation day celebrations at Telangana Bhavan, after unfurling the flag on Tuesday, the Congress ascended to power by repeating those same lies in the form of declarations and 420 promises.“The Congress party has polluted Telangana politics with lies, fabrications, and poisonous propaganda.While the entire country got rid of Congress as a curse, it has come to Telangana,” he said..Even though exactly half the term has elapsed, this Congress government has achieved nothing, KTR said and added the party struggle is not for power, but for the people of Telangana.“In 30 months, it has brought Telangana crashing down in all sectors. There is no section that has not been deceived under Congress rule. Agriculture, which was progressing happily, has sunk into crisis. There is no Rythu Bandhu, no one to provide fertilizers, and finally, even after 2 months of harvesting crops, there is no one to purchase them. It is painful to see the misfortune where even falling at the government’s feet evokes no mercy,” he said.The BRS leader said with the intention of defaming KCR, Congress has harbored vengeance against irrigation projects. “Revanth Reddy is an incapable and incompetent Chief Minister who cannot provide urea, who cannot procure Paddy, did not pay Rythu Bandhu, did not give jobs to the unemployed youth,” he said.“Rahul Gandhi also deceived unemployed students and youth by making them sit at Ashok Nagar.In 2.5 years, the Congress govt has not provided even 4,000 new jobs — what has Rahul Gandhi been doing for the remaining 2.5 years? Rahul Gandhi should come to Chikkadpally library and Ashok Nagar Chowrasta to debate on this,” he said.The BRS working president said the BRS would contest alone in the next elections, and earlier the party has always contested alone and won alone after Telangana formation.ends/
